    1. Recruiting & Onboarding Made Simple 

    Recruiting and onboarding new employees is one of the most important functions of an HR department and there is a lot of work that goes into recruiting top talent for your organization. Screening resumes, sourcing candidates, and assessing talent are crucial and time-consuming tasks that are everyday activities for an HR department. AI based solutions can streamline these tasks, freeing up time and resources.  

    An example of AI-powered HR software is an applicant tracking system (ATS). These applications can sort through tons of resumes to find top candidates for your organization based on keywords matching up with the right qualifications and skills. This allows those working in your HR department to save time and focus on building a relationship with the right people you are looking to hire. Great onboarding can improve employee retention by 82%. This is also true after the candidate is hired. AI can provide efficient and personalized onboarding instructions and processes for new hires.  

    2. The Employee Experience 

    Maximizing and improving your employees’ overall experience is crucial in retaining top talent. There are a variety of tools and applications that can help improve an employee’s time at your company. There are AI training tools that can be tailored to fit your new hire’s needs and begin their journey on the right track. Another popular AI tool is chatbots. Chatbots allow people to get instant feedback and solutions if they are encountering any issues so that they can get tasks and training done efficiently.  

    3. Decrease Subjective Influence 

    A big challenge for HR departments is maintaining fairness and remaining objective. AI can take the subjectiveness out of the hiring process by analyzing the applicant’s data and not their gender or ethnicity. AI can also monitor HR department practices for signs that will lead to unfairness and promote diversity, equity, and inclusion in the workplace. By encouraging pro-DEI practices, AI can contribute to creating a fairer and more just workplace. 

    4. Future Planning 

    AI is becoming increasingly popular, and companies are taking advantage of this. The AI market is growing at a rate of approximately 40 percent each year. By having AI handle the repetitive data driven tasks, your human resources department can focus on the interpersonal relationships that are crucial to supporting a successful business or organization. In the future, 92 percent of HR leaders intend to increase their AI use in at least one area of HR. The planned use of AI can also save your organization money. Because AI gives you insights on best hiring practices, you can save money by allocating time and resources elsewhere and focusing on making your organization more efficient.
